kill

12 senses ·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. n. A kiln. Source: opted
  2. 2. n. A channel or arm of the sea; a river; a stream; as, the channel between Staten Island and Bergen Neck is the Kill van Kull, or the Kills; -- used also in composition; as, Schuylkill, Catskill, etc. Source: opted
  3. 3. v. t. To deprive of life, animal or vegetable, in any manner or by any means; to render inanimate; to put to death; to slay. Source: opted
  4. 4. v. t. To destroy; to ruin; as, to kill one's chances; to kill the sale of a book. Source: opted
  5. 5. v. t. To cause to cease; to quell; to calm; to still; as, in seamen's language, a shower of rain kills the wind. Source: opted
  6. 6. v. t. To destroy the effect of; to counteract; to neutralize; as, alkali kills acid. Source: opted
  7. 7. n. the act of terminating a life Source: wordnet
  8. 8. n. the destruction of an enemy plane or ship or tank or missile Source: wordnet
  9. 9. n. the body of an animal, or bodies of animals, killed by a person or another animal Source: wordnet
  10. 10. v. cause to die; put to death, usually intentionally or knowingly Source: wordnet
  11. 11. v. thwart the passage of Source: wordnet
  12. 12. v. end or extinguish by forceful means Source: wordnet
